I’ve spent my fair share of time on Facebook mum groups over recent years and it seems there’s not a lot we can agree on, breast or bottle? Co-sleeping or solitude? Dummies or comforters? Purees or baby-led weaning? But one thing I do see fairly consistently is the hate towards sleep training. Most recently I’ve seen Instagram influencers posting their success with sleep training, followed by screenshots from other mums making them feel guilty for putting their child through something so traumatic. I get it, I was once an exhausted mum who hated the thought of my kid crying for even 5 seconds. Then I bit the bullet and called in a pro. 3 days later I had a whole new kid, a LOT more patience and so much more to give.

It seems that the only options most parents see available to them are either 1. Answering every peep, hoping if they make it fast enough to bub that they’ll fall back to sleep quickly or 2. Leaving them to wail the night away until everyone in the house is awake and traumatised. Years of the term ā€˜cry-it-out’ being used as sleep training has us all terrified to even ask for help. Of course, no one wants to leave their child to believe that no one is coming for them, parents have spent this small person’s entire life building their trust and securing attachment.

I want to change this.

As your child grows, their sleep needs are continually changing which means we need to adjust their schedule.

🌜 If bub is fighting bedtime, they probably don’t have enough sleep pressure for an easy sleep onset. Early mornings and night wakings may also be a sign baby is ready to drop a nap as they don’t have the sleep pressure to facilitate a full night sleep.

🌜If you are following age appropriate awake windows and finding that it’s getting too hard to fit in a full wake window or that bedtime is becoming to late in the evening, it is time to ditch that nap.

šŸŒ™ Stretch wake windows out and bring bedtime forward while baby makes the transition.

While naps are important, night sleep is far deeper and more restorative.

Following an age appropriate guide to awake windows is so helpful in finding that sweet spot for great sleep.
An over tired baby may experience false starts, early rising, catnaps, not to mention irritability. Where as an under tired baby may have a hard time falling asleep, have split night sleep, early rising or only ever catnap.
